2.4 Network Connection

The EKI-2728MI has 6 x RJ-45 and 2 Fiber ports that support connection to 10 Mbps
Ethernet, 100 Mbps Fast Ethernet, or 1000 Mbps Gigabit Ethernet, and half or full
duplex operation. EKI-2728MI can be connected to other hubs/switches through a
twisted-pair straight-through cable or a crossover cable up to 100m long. The
connection can be made from any TX port of the EKI-2728MI (MDI-X) to another hub
or switch either MDI-X or uplink MDI port.
The EKI-2728MI supports auto-crossover to make networking more easy and flexible.
You can connect any RJ-45 (MDI-X) station port on the switch to any device such as a
switch, bridge or router.

You can connect an alarm indicator, buzzer or other signaling equipment through the
relay output. The relay opens if power input 1 or 2 fails ('Open' means if you connect
relay output with an LED, the light would be off).
